Biomarkers, bioinformatics, and nanotechnology coming together to create individualized cancer treatment

Joseph Michael

Biomarker disclosure, Biocomputing, and nanotechnology have raised new open doors for the arising field of customized medication in which sickness identification, analysis, and treatment are custom-made to every individual's sub-atomic profile, and furthermore for prescient medication that utilizes hereditary sub-atomic data to anticipate illness advancement, movement, and clinical result. Multiplexed nanoparticle probes for cancer biomarker profiling and advanced Biocomputing tools for cancer biomarker discovery are the topics of this article, as are the opportunities and challenges associated with tying bio molecular signatures to clinical outcomes. For personalized treatment and molecular diagnosis of cancer and other human diseases, this convergence of bio-nano-information holds great promise.
